Poker is a family of card games. Each variant has its own rules and deck configuration. However, the basic gameplay is the same. Players make bets using chips and match bets with their opponents. The player with the best hand wins the pot.

There are thousands of variations of the game, but there are a few basic rules that apply to any poker game. A good knowledge of these rules is helpful to players, and they also help improve the atmosphere at the table.
